Output 629bd38f08910fc0b371601dc91dfa05ddc886fce82f9bc7f730fd0565ea8833:85

value
863
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2eae0bf19762a433cee795b82676636938c8323fe0312914fcd1b2050970054d
address
bc1p96hqhuvhv2jr8nh8jkuzvanrdyuvsv3luqcjj98u6xeq2ztsq4xse6zd8r
transaction
629bd38f08910fc0b371601dc91dfa05ddc886fce82f9bc7f730fd0565ea8833
confirmations
115072
spent
true